Research and Development Manager manages and directs the research and development programs to meet organizational needs and to capitalize on potential new products. Develops and implements research and development procedures and techniques. Being a Research and Development Manager oversees complex research projects, analyzes results and provides recommendations based on findings. Assesses the scope of research projects and ensures they are on time and within budget. Additionally, Research and Development Manager may require an advanced degree. Typically reports to a head of unit/director. The Research and Development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be a Research and Development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. La Crosse is located on the western border of the midsection of Wisconsin, on a broad alluvial plain along the east side of the Mississippi River. The Black River empties into the Mississippi north of the city, and the La Crosse River flows into the Mississippi just north of the downtown area. Just upriver from its mouth, this river broadens into a marshland that splits the city into two distinct sections, north and south.
